Electric wheelchairs can be a significant investment, and it’s essential to consider financing options or insurance coverage. Some health insurance plans cover part of the cost, so check with your provider to understand your benefits. Additionally, some manufacturers offer financing plans to make payments more manageable.

In terms of hygiene, chair latrines can be equipped with a variety of features to enhance cleanliness and odor control. Some models include a cover for the waste receptacle, while others may incorporate basic handwashing facilities nearby. Promoting good hygiene practices, such as regular handwashing after using the toilet, is crucial in preventing the spread of disease, especially in crowded or resource-limited settings.

Medical bed chairs are specially designed chairs that can be adjusted to various positions, allowing patients to sit upright or recline as needed. They often come equipped with features such as height adjustment, tilt functions, and support for the lower and upper body, making them versatile for different care scenarios. These chairs are commonly used in hospitals, nursing homes, and home care settings.
